**Limits & Quotas — Murella Audio Guide**

Each visitor session is rate-limited per device. Audio asset downloads are capped daily; exceeding the cap returns 429 with no retry hint. Quotas reset at midnight local gallery time. All limits are enforced at the edge proxy, not the app. The enforced constants are as follows.

tuning constants:
QUOTAS = {
    "quenael": 10,
    "oliwyn": 1,
}

# Break-Glass: Quillbus Broker Upgrade

Use only if the standard Quillbus upgrade pipeline is down and brokers must be patched immediately.

1. Page the secondary on-call before proceeding.
2. Drain traffic from the target node via the Harrowgate control plane.
3. Apply the staged package from the offline mirror.
4. Verify queue depth returns to baseline within ten minutes.

Break-glass access to the control plane requires the emergency credential vault, which unlocks with the passphrase below.

recovery phrase for tagag-tadug: caswyn-ralwyn

## Deploying the Gatewick Proctor Queue

Deploys are pretty painless: push to main, wait for the pipeline, then watch the queue drain dashboard for five minutes. If candidates pile up mid-exam, roll back first and ask questions later — the queue replays safely. Everything the workers care about lives in one config block, shown here for reference.

settings of bafof-yagef:
JOROX_PIN=8740
JOROX_TENANT=pelox
JOROX_METRICS_HOST=metrics.jorox.qorvelworks.internal
JOROX_SEAL=seal_c78f63c1
JOROX_STANDBY_TEAM=norax

**Q4 Planning Note — Sales Leads**

Budget request submitted: 18% uplift for field operations. Covers two additional reps in the Penhallow territory, refreshed demo kits for the Corvane line, and travel for the Drellwick trade circuit. Finance pushed back on the demo kits; expect a revised figure Friday. No discretionary spend approvals until the request clears. Pipeline targets stand regardless of outcome. Keep forecasts conservative. The note below explains why, and it does not leave this group.

internal memo for yahag-hahig: Belwynix Group plans to lower the Silir list price by 62 percent in May.